Cimatron E11 eliminates this friction by providing a unified environment. A single model file contains both the geometric design data and the manufacturing toolpaths. If a client requests a modification to a mold cavity, the designer updates the CAD model, and the CAM programmer can update the NC toolpaths with a single click. This seamless associativity drastically reduces engineering time and eliminates translation errors. Advanced CAD Capabilities for Tool Design

: These areas were a primary focus, introducing tools that dramatically reduced design time. Key additions included an ECO Manager for efficient integration of engineering change orders, one-click creation of internal parting surfaces and lifter pockets, and advanced cooling system design and analysis tools. The flexible, user-friendly die design environment also enabled concurrent work by several designers on a single project.
